One of the most significant advancements in site surveying and data collection for construction projects is the integration of drone technology. Drones empower teams by providing precise and real-time data, which is crucial for making informed decisions throughout the project lifecycle. Capable of capturing high-resolution images and 3D models from above, drones enhance site surveying accuracy, leading to a more comprehensive understanding of the terrain and environment. This capability drastically reduces the need for manual labor that was traditionally required to measure and assess large project sites, thereby minimizing human error and speeding up the data collection process.
The efficiency brought about by drones in site surveying not only improves project timeframes but also enhances data precision and reliability. In the ever-evolving landscape of construction project management, drone technology stands out as a pivotal tool for safety enhancement and risk management. By utilizing innovative drone applications, construction managers are fundamentally transforming how sites are monitored and inspected. Drones minimize the need for personnel to access potentially hazardous areas, effectively reducing the risk of accidents and injuries. Capable of capturing high-resolution images and videos, drones provide detailed insights into site conditions without exposing workers to potential dangers. This aerial perspective is invaluable for continuous risk assessment, ensuring that teams are informed of any safety threats before they escalate.
